INSTRUCTIONS
Mix sugar, water, and zest in a saucepan and bring to a boil. Reduce heat,
cover partially and cook until the mixture is syrupy. Let cool slightly,
remove the zest, and add the liqueur. Mix well. This will keep in the
refrigerator. Use approximately a tablespoon per serving on bread pudding.
Amaretto is also good on bread pudding.
